We have gathered the up-to-date information for the 2012 Alaska cruise schedules for the cruise liners such as; Princess Cruises, Holland America Lines, Royal Caribbean Cruise Lines, Celebrity Cruises and Regent Seven Seas for your convenience. All of these cruise departures are one-way in nature. The northbound departures are from Vancouver, BC, and the southbound departures are from Seward, Alaska or Whittier, Alaska. Continue reading

Alaska Fishing Vacations
Alaska is one of the most popular fishing destinations in the world, and with good reason! In Alaska you can find innumerable fish: Salmon, Trout, Dolly Varden, Northern Pike, Grayling, Halibut Rock Fish, and more! And in the summer, you can practically fish all night with the midnight sun keeping the waters illuminated. Alaska is all about fishing; it’s still a main source of food for many Alaskans, and is imprinted on our culture. Continue reading
